Foreign Companies to pay Tax on all Revenue from Seismic Data contracts

Foreign firms operating in the country will have to pay tax at the existing rate of 4.223 per cent on revenue earned under seismic data acquisition and processing contracts, says a tribunal. Withholding Tax not required to be deducted by Indian Company for data processing services

Indian firms outsourcing routine work to their overseas subsidiaries would not have to deduct withholding tax on the payments made to them. In a landmark ruling, the Authority of Advance Ruling (AAR) has held that firms are exempted from deducting the withholding tax on the payments made for services like transcription and data processing. Solar PV farms exempted from MoEF clearance

India's ministry of environment and forests (MoEF) has exempted the solar PV farms coming up in the country from having to seek environment clearance.
